Our advanced Gas Control Systems provide professional, customizable remote monitoring and management solutions for a wide array of gas equipment. Specialized for CNG, LNG, and city portal stations, these systems integrate high-performance PLC microcomputer processing units with intelligent control instruments and optimized software to ensure maximum automation and operational simplicity.

By leveraging the latest Internet of Things (IoT) technology and a cloud-based management platform, our systems transform traditional gas infrastructure into digitized assets. From precise pressure regulation to real-time accident alarms and remote data transmission, we provide the critical safety and efficiency layer required for modern energy distribution networks.

Key Advantages

Enhanced Safety

Automatic equipment shutdown, accident alarms, and pressure cut-off mechanisms prevent hazardous leaks and overpressure.

Real-time Monitoring

Continuous timing acquisition and uploading of operational data for constant visibility of site health.

IoT Connectivity

Seamless integration of NB-IoT and 4G technology for stable, long-distance remote data transmission.

Intelligent Control

Automatic heat exchange temperature control and programmable software based on specific process flows.

Digitized Management

Full digitization of equipment operation and safety management, allowing for precise accident tracing.

Energy Efficient

Sleep and timing wake-up functions optimize power consumption for battery-operated remote devices.

Frequently Asked Questions

Q: Can this control system be integrated with my existing SCADA?

Yes, our system is designed to make full use of existing SCADA data acquisition systems, ensuring a seamless fusion of data and management without replacing your entire infrastructure.

Q: What happens if the primary power supply fails?

The system supports flexible power options, including 220V mains and a combination of solar panels with UPS (Uninterruptible Power Supply) to ensure continuous operation.

Q: How does the system handle extreme temperature changes?

The software automatically controls the heat exchange temperature of the equipment and can trigger an automatic cut-off at critical low temperatures to protect the system.

Q: Which communication protocols are supported for remote transmission?

We support a comprehensive range of modes, including 4G, NB-IoT, Wifi, and both wired and wireless communication to suit different geographic requirements.

Q: Is the system programmable for custom industrial processes?

Absolutely. The control software can be programmed and customized according to your specific process flows and operational requirements.

Q: How long do the batteries last for remote transmission devices?

For remote transmission devices operating on battery power, the system is optimized for low consumption, ensuring an operational lifespan of no less than two years.
